Одной из причин резидуальной ротационной нестабильности у пациентов с разрывами передней крестообразной связки после идеально проведенной пластики является нелеченное повреждение антеролатеральной связки (АЛС) коленного сустава. Последние десятилетия в литературе широко обсуждаются вопросы анатомических особенностей АЛС, вклада ее повреждений в ротационную нестабильность коленного сустава, а также способы диагностики и лечения последней. Однако взгляды ученых на принципиальные вопросы, касающиеся анатомии и структурно-функциональных особенностей АЛС, а следовательно, на способы и целесообразность восстановления иногда диаметрально противоположны. Это приводит к неопределенности диагностических критериев и затрудняет выбор оптимальных способов лечения. Диагностика повреждений АЛС с помощью магниторезонансной томографии на сегодняшний день находится на грани своих возможностей. Нами установлены причины разногласий между исследователями в вопросах анатомии АЛС и оптимальных способов диагностики и лечения ее повреждений, а также предложены пути решения этих вопросов.
